SUBJECT:

ACCEPTANCE REVIEW FOR BECHTEL QUALITY ASSURANCE PROGRAM FOR NUCLEAR POWER PLANTS TOPICAL REPORT, BQ-TOP-1, 2007 EDITION, REVISION 003

Dear Mr. Rezk:

By letter dated July 31, 2018 (Agencywide Documents Access and Management System (ADAMS) Accession No. ML18112A363), Bechtel Power Corporation (Bechtel) submitted for U.S. Nuclear Regulatory Commission (NRC) staff review Bechtel Quality Assurance Program for Nuclear Power Plants Topical Report, BQ-Top-1, 2007 Edition, Revision 003. A copy of Revision 3 along with supporting information can be found in the ADAMS Package Accession No. ML18212A362.

The NRC staff has performed an acceptance review of Revision 3. We have found that the material presented is sufficient to begin our review. The NRC staff expects to issue its request for additional information by November 30, 2018, and issue its draft safety evaluation by May 29, 2019. This schedule information takes into consideration the NRCs current review priorities and available technical resources and may be subject to change. If modifications to these dates are deemed necessary, we will provide appropriate updates to this information.

The NRC staff estimates that the review will require approximately 100 hours0.00116 days <br />0.0278 hours <br />1.653439e-4 weeks <br />3.805e-5 months <br />, including project management and contractor effort. This estimate of hours includes the hours already expended on completing this acceptance review.

Section 170.21 of Title 10 of the Code of Federal Regulations requires that topical reports are subject to fees based on the full cost of the review. You did not request a fee waiver; therefore, the NRC staff hours will be billed accordingly.
